Mount Lewis suburb profile
Mount Lewis is a small, residential suburb in the south-western region of Sydney, New South Wales. Known for its peaceful atmosphere and community-oriented vibe, it offers a suburban retreat from the hustle and bustle of city life. The suburb is characterized by its leafy streets and a mix of older homes and modern residences, catering to a diverse population. Its proximity to larger suburbs like Bankstown provides residents with access to a wide range of amenities, including shopping, dining, and recreational facilities. Mount Lewis demographics
Mount Lewis, a small suburb in the Canterbury-Bankstown region of Sydney, offers a serene and family-friendly environment. With a population of 1,234, it provides a close-knit community atmosphere. The median age of 37 suggests a mature population, with many residents likely to be established families and professionals. The suburb's appeal to families is evident, with 59.6% of households being couple families with children, highlighting its suitability for those seeking a nurturing environment for raising children.
Housing in Mount Lewis is characterized by a significant proportion of home ownership, with 35.7% of properties owned outright and 32.9% owned with a mortgage. This indicates a stable community with long-term residents who have invested in the area. The rental market, comprising 31.4% of properties, provides options for those seeking flexibility, including young families and professionals who may be new to the area.
The median total household income of $1,539 per week reflects a comfortable standard of living, aligning with the suburb's family-oriented nature. The presence of one-parent families, making up 16.3% of the community, adds to the diversity of family structures in Mount Lewis. Mount Lewis infrastructure, key developments and investment opportunities
Mount Lewis is a small, elevated suburb within the Canterbury-Bankstown local government area, benefiting from proximity to the larger centres of Bankstown and Greenacre, which provide extensive retail, dining, and employment options likely to underpin local housing demand.[2][4] The suburb’s quiet, low-density character, combined with views from its higher streets and access to nearby parks such as Mount Lewis Park, supports its appeal for families and long-term owner-occupiers.[4][9]
There are currently no widely publicised, suburb-specific major infrastructure or redevelopment projects in Mount Lewis itself that are expected to significantly alter the local property market in the short term.[5] However, broader Canterbury-Bankstown Council initiatives to improve local amenities and transport connections across the region, along with incremental infill redevelopment and renovations, are likely to gradually enhance livability and sustain steady buyer interest in the area over time.[4][5]
